If you have only a motherboard I suspect the service tag would not be much use.
A Google search brings up references:
Motherboard ID:: 51-2300-000000-00101111-030199-$EA815
Motherboard Name:: Intel Easton D815EEA / Easton 2 D815E(P)EA2 / Fayetteville D185E(p)FV

If this board came out of a Dell system, you should be able to go into BIOS Setup where you will be able to find the service tag number. Also, I'm not so sure the Intel BIOS will work on the Dell board. If you flashed it and the board is functioning, let us know. Otherwise, I would do a little more research to ID the board and download the correct BIOS upgrade from the Dell site.
